The 777 isn't exactly high level sensitive technology. It's a commercial product sold and operated in large numbers all over the world.
If the Russians wanted to reverse engineer a 20 year old airliner there would be far easier ways to get hold of an example other than arranging the theft of one during a scheduled airline flight with 239 people on board. They could for example, just buy one.
Or they could have just taken a really close look at the 777s that Aeroflot operated a few years back.
